Overview

NordFX was founded in 2008 and is headquartered in Mauritius, while XGLOBAL Markets was established in 2008 and is based in Cyprus. NordFX holds licences including VFSC (15008), while XGLOBAL Markets is regulated by Cyprus Securities and Exchange Commission (CySEC) among others. NordFX serves 10,000+ clients worldwide; XGLOBAL Markets has 10,000+. The minimum deposit is $10 at NordFX and $500 at XGLOBAL Markets.

Fees

Fees are a critical factor when choosing between NordFX and XGLOBAL Markets, directly affecting your bottom line as a trader. NordFX has a lower barrier to entry with a minimum deposit of $10 (vs $500 at XGLOBAL Markets). XGLOBAL Markets charges withdrawal fees while NordFX does not, giving NordFX an edge for frequent withdrawers. NordFX applies inactivity fees on dormant accounts; XGLOBAL Markets does not. XGLOBAL Markets charges deposit fees; NordFX does not. Overall, NordFX scores higher on fees in our assessment.

Platforms

NordFX offers MT4, MT5, while XGLOBAL Markets supports MT4, MT5, cTrader. Both brokers provide mobile trading apps for iOS and Android. NordFX supports social and copy trading features, which XGLOBAL Markets does not offer. XGLOBAL Markets edges ahead on platform breadth and functionality in our scoring.

Deposits & Withdrawals

Convenient deposit and withdrawal options reduce friction for traders, especially important when managing positions across time zones. NordFX accepts 4 of the tracked payment methods (bank transfer, credit/debit card, Skrill, Neteller), while XGLOBAL Markets supports 2 (bank transfer, credit/debit card). NordFX uniquely supports Skrill and Neteller among the two brokers. NordFX scores higher on deposit and withdrawal flexibility.
